Google has expanded its AI-powered app creation tool, Opal, to 15 new countries, allowing users to build mini web apps using text prompts. The app, previously available only in the U.S., now includes Canada, India, Japan, South Korea, and Brazil, among others. Google aims to provide more creators globally with this innovative tool. Opal's expansion follows a successful U.S. launch in July, where users demonstrated significant creativity. The tool has also received performance and debugging enhancements.
